RTF Zagis in Dallas area hobby shop

For you people that are too busy to even tape together a Zagi (and happen to live in North Texas):

I was over at Mike's Hobby Shop in Carrolton the other day. He has a local builder doing Zagis for his shop.

With the little three channel Hitec FM, the built Zagi 400X was selling for 299.95. They looked to be very well done and neater than average.
